Vapour chamber cooling tipped for the iPhone
Beyond the design rumours another leak suggests Apples foldable iPhone could feature vapour chamber cooling technology. If true this would make the device one of the iPhones to include the advanced thermal management system.
Vapour chamber cooling is designed to improve heat dissipation by using a chamber containing liquid that evaporates and condenses as temperatures rise in the iPhone. The process helps spread heat efficiently across the device reducing thermal buildup during demanding tasks such as gaming on the iPhone, video editing and AI processing.
The technology has become increasingly common in premium Android smartphones. Recently made its way to Apples Pro iPhone models.
Why thermal management matters in a phone
Foldable smartphones face additional engineering challenges compared to traditional smartphones. Their thinner designs, flexible displays and complex hinge mechanisms can make heat management more difficult for the iPhone.
By incorporating vapour chamber cooling Apple could ensure performance even when running resource-intensive applications on the iPhone. Better thermal control may also help preserve battery life and improve the long-term reliability of components in the iPhone.
